import { Amount } from "./amount"; import { LineItem } from "./lineItem"; import { Split } from "./split"; export declare class PaymentAmountUpdateResponse { "amount": Amount; /** * The reason for the amount update. Possible values: * **delayedCharge** * **noShow** * **installment** */ "industryUsage"?: PaymentAmountUpdateResponse.IndustryUsageEnum; /** * Price and product information of the refunded items, required for [partial refunds](https://docs.adyen.com/online-payments/refund#refund-a-payment). > This field is required for partial refunds with 3x 4x Oney, Affirm, Afterpay, Atome, Clearpay, Klarna, Ratepay, Walley, and Zip. */ "lineItems"?: Array<LineItem>; /** * The merchant account that is used to process the payment. */ "merchantAccount": string; /** * The [`pspReference`](https://docs.adyen.com/api-explorer/Checkout/latest/post/payments#responses-200-pspReference) of the payment to update. */ "paymentPspReference": string; /** * Adyen\'s 16-character reference associated with the amount update request. */ "pspReference": string; /** * Your reference for the amount update request. Maximum length: 80 characters. */ "reference": string; /** * An array of objects specifying how the amount should be split between accounts when using Adyen for Platforms. For more information, see how to process payments for [marketplaces](https://docs.adyen.com/marketplaces/process-payments) or [platforms](https://docs.adyen.com/platforms/process-payments). */ "splits"?: Array<Split>; /** * The status of your request. This will always have the value **received**. */ "status": PaymentAmountUpdateResponse.StatusEnum; static readonly discriminator: string | undefined; static readonly mapping: { [index: string]: string; } | undefined; static readonly attributeTypeMap: Array<{ name: string; baseName: string; type: string; format: string; }>; static getAttributeTypeMap(): { name: string; baseName: string; type: string; format: string; }[]; constructor(); } export declare namespace PaymentAmountUpdateResponse { enum IndustryUsageEnum { DelayedCharge = "delayedCharge", Installment = "installment", NoShow = "noShow" } enum StatusEnum { Received = "received" } }
